Topic Dog Boards / General / what questions do i need to ask?
- By lizzie10 [gb] Date 12.08.05 11:40 UTC
hello all,
we are in the process of ringing breeders and viewing litters,I know some of the questions i should be asking,such as why the litter was bred,what else should i be asking?
- By Brainless [gb] Date 12.08.05 11:58 UTC
Health test results.  If you want a pup to show then you might want to know how the parents have done in the ring, or if one for work then how good they were in that sphere.

Preferably the breeder should be knowledgeable in their chosen breed so that they can offer you the necesary support.  If they are a first time breeder you would want to know that they have bred with the mentoring and back up of someone very expoereinced so that they can still offer you this.

You also need to like the breeder, after all they will be your first port of call if you have any queries.
- By colliesrus [gb] Date 12.08.05 12:07 UTC
And make sure there is nothing that that says anything about 'No Known Health Problems' because that just means they haven't had the health tests done!
- By Polly [gb] Date 12.08.05 18:10 UTC
Your vet or the breed club of your chosen breed should be able to tell you what health checks are relevant to the breed, then you can do the research and ask the right questions.
- By Liisa [gb] Date 16.08.05 14:40 UTC
yep what health tests both parents have had (and can they show you evidence), how many litters they breed per annum, how long they have been in the breed, what age the puppies will be going to new homes, what socialisation they have had and will have prior to going to new homes, have they been wormed, what have they been weaned on, can you see mum, there are loads and I am sure some will crop up when you speak to them  - they should also ask you lots of questions too :-)
- By Liisa [gb] Date 16.08.05 14:41 UTC
oh and will they take the dog back if things dont work out for whatever reason
